Output dce6be74950a56bd4b34711bb3e8f0b6cbcee8a228fb004b1baf83306bb641c2:1

value
18555230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b63ca8cbf1781a32e4482ea4cc1ab56a7aeb3d9a OP_EQUAL
address
3JJba9G8XhEHed5P3TgbbqfEggij1KfzvX
transaction
dce6be74950a56bd4b34711bb3e8f0b6cbcee8a228fb004b1baf83306bb641c2
confirmations
225369
spent
true